Summary
Essex Property Trust, Inc. (ESS) has entered into a material definitive agreement with Cantor Fitzgerald & Co. to facilitate the sale of common stock. This agreement allows Essex to offer up to 2,000,000 shares of its common stock through at-the-market or negotiated transactions. The primary purpose of this arrangement is to provide Essex with a flexible mechanism to raise capital, likely to fund ongoing operations, future acquisitions, or development projects within its real estate portfolio.
